Hunger
Denes McIntosh

She's hungry, and she's homeless
she's left layin' by the road
a mother cryin' "won't you take my child to your home
and give her shelter".

Chorus:
"Give her something for her hunger
something for her soul
something for her sadness
and something for the cold
that's been growin' in her heart
tearin' her apart
and keepin' her from ever bein' whole".

The hard side of the tracks
in every hometown USA
growing weary of the struggle
gettin' tougher every day
to keep from letting go.

Chorus:
"give them. . . "

Inner city families
no earth between their toes
momma's runnin' down a hustle
you know how the story goes
it's not a pretty one.

Chorus:
"give them. . ."

Suburban middle class
has all the new computer toys
but the bills are overdue
and daddy's drinkin' with the boys
till early mornin'.

Chorus:
"give him. . ."

Hollywood mentality
borders on insanity
pleasure seeking fantasy
a crippling disease
you know it's tragic.
